AppBank Posts 519 Million Yen Loss as Revenue Hits 1.24 Billion

Tokyo-listed AppBank Inc. reported a net loss of 519 million yen for the fiscal year ending December 31, 2025, highlighting ongoing bottom-line pressure for the Japanese digital services provider.

Breakdown of Annual Results

The company’s annual revenue reached 1.24 billion yen, yet high costs and operational headwinds pulled the firm into the red. According to the latest financial filing, AppBank recorded an operating loss of 170 million yen and a pretax loss of 185 million yen, underscoring the gap between its top-line performance and operational efficiency.

The net loss translated to a deficit of 29.27 yen per share. These figures, reported under Japanese accounting standards, reflect a challenging period for the firm as it navigates a competitive domestic market for mobile-related media and commerce.

While the company maintained a revenue stream exceeding the billion-yen mark, the significant disparity between gross earnings and the final net result suggests substantial expenses or structural shifts during the fiscal year.
